AGENDA ITEM SUMMARY <br /> LEXINGTON BOARD OF SELECTMEN MEETING <br /> AGENDA ITEM TITLE: <br /> Water/Sewer Abatement Appeals (15 min) <br /> PRESENTER: ITEM <br /> NUMBER: <br /> Resident Appeals <br /> 1.2 <br /> SUMMARY- <br /> Water/Sewer customers who believe their bills are incorrect may file an appeal. The process is: <br /> 1. Owner/customer files written appeal with DPW Water/Sewer Business Manager; <br /> 2. Business Manager makes a recommendation to the Water/Sewer Abatement Board(WSAB); <br /> 3. WSAB, at a public meeting, makes a determination on the appeal and staff recommendation; <br /> 4. If the customer does not agree with this determination, they can present their case directly to the WSAB <br /> for further consideration; <br /> 5. If the customer still does not agree with the determination of the WSAB, they can appeal to the Board of <br /> Selectmen. <br /> The Assistant Town Manager for Finance recommends that the Board hear both appeals and take them under <br /> advisement, for a subsequent analysis and Board determination. <br /> SUGGESTED MOTION: <br /> FOLLOW-UP: <br /> Assistant Town Manager will undertake further review based on Board questions. <br /> DATE AND APPROXIMATE TIME ON AGENDA: <br /> 5/2/2016 <br /> ATTACHMENTS: <br />
